The ability for information to pass from generation to … WebMar 5, 2024 · Predicting Offspring Phenotypes. You can predict the percentages of phenotypes in the offspring of this cross from their genotypes.B is dominant to b, so offspring with either the BB or Bb genotype will have the purple-flower phenotype. WebGenotype: The genetic makeup of a cell for existing traits that refers to a combination of two alleles. Example: You have the genotype for being very susceptible to a particular disease. Phenotype: A trait that is observed or … WebFeb 7, 2024 · To find possible genotypes locate different combinations of alleles - AA, Aa, or aa. You can determine the genotypic ratio by counting the number of occurrences of each genotype. Based on the possible genotypes, you can assess the phenotypes.
